Chicken Barley Noodle Soup Nutrition Values

Nutrients 100 gr 1 Portion (Medium)
Calories (kcal) 82 165
Carbohydrate (g) 9.2 18.5
Protein (g) 2.8 5.6
Fat (g) 3 5.9
Fiber (g) 0.9 1.9
Cholesterol (mg) 8.1 16.1
Sodium (mg) 152.2 304.5
Potassium (mg) 258.7 517.5
Calcium (mg) 18.1 36.2
Iron (mg) 0.86 1.71
Vitamin A (IU) 87 173.9
Vitamin C (mg) 21.2 42.3

Nutritional values are based on the USDA database. Natural variations may occur; this information is for informational purposes only and does not constitute medical advice.
